Component video cables are undoubtedly the highest quality analog video type available. The quality of video that component offers is sometimes comparable to HDMI. Component video cables are capable of resolutions of up to 1080p in case your High definition tv set permits 1080p through component. Contrary to the majority of analogue cables which are only able to carry 480i screen resolutions, component can carry 480i, 480p, 720p, and 1080i and progressive.
If you are not exactly positive that your devices require a component video cable, it's easy to identify them by the color of the ports. Component video cables are tagged with red, green, and blue connections. The device additionally probably has them classed as (Y, Pr, Pb / Y, Cr, Cb).
Question: So what is a component cable designed for?
Answer: Component video cables can be used for hooking up component video compatible devices. Component video is a video connection which keeps the primary color elements individually as an alternative to merging them in to a solo transmission (such as with composite video). This generates a transmission having a increased colour data transfer rate in contrast to composite video. The color components are Y, Cb, and Cr for typical component video, and Y, Pb, and Pr for high def component video.
Question:Precisely what connection or connections are used with this particular cable?
Answer: Component video cables include 3 RCA plugs on each side.
